Introduction to Everton Football Club
Everton is a football club competing in England’s Premier League. Based in the city of Liverpool, the team has a large and loyal fanbase.
Historically, Everton has achieved impressive success, including 5 FA Cup titles and finishing first in the top division of English football nine times. The club is known for its consistent performance, strategic gameplay, and technical prowess—qualities highly praised by both fans and experts.

Founded in the late 19th century, Everton is one of the oldest and most traditional football clubs in England. In fact, they were one of the founding members of the top-flight league and won the championship just two seasons after its inception.
Despite their proud history, expectations for Everton in recent seasons have diminished. In the 2020/21 Premier League, the team finished 10th—considered a disappointing result, especially compared to their local rivals Liverpool, who had an outstanding season. New Signings in the 2021/22 Season
To bet effectively on Everton, it’s essential to understand their current squad. Recently, the club acquired three notable players: Demarai Gray, Asmir Begovic, and Andros Townsend. Though these transfers didn’t break the bank, they were considered successful moves by Everton’s management.
Details on New Players:
Demarai Gray – Born in 1996, the English winger was part of the Leicester City squad that won the Premier League in 2016. Known for his energy and willingness to improve, Gray has also played for England’s U21 team.
Asmir Begovic – A Bosnian goalkeeper born in 1987, Begovic previously played for Chelsea and helped them win a Premier League title. Between 2007 and 2013, he was repeatedly recognized as a top-performing keeper.
Andros Townsend – Born in 1991, this English winger formerly played for Tottenham Hotspur and brings Premier League experience to Everton’s midfield.
